PostPosted: Mon Mar 14, 2005 12:32 am


On the one hand the old Last Chancers, with the Chapter Approved rules and not those listed in the old Codex: Imperial Guard could wreak serious havoc, but some weren't as effective. And they require hella care and timing to be super effective.

The new rules allow for a small Penal platoon, which can be more effective with larger sub-groups and veterans with stolen crap. My only boon is that they shouldn't have slotted Kage in with the entry. Kage is dead, so what use it he now! Besides, he prefers lasguns and knives over a bolt pistol damnit!
